下载Linux代码:学习开源操作系统编程的必备步骤(linux代码下载)

下载Linux代码:学习开源操作系统编程的必备步骤

Linux是一款重要的开源操作系统,它具有高度可定制性、灵活性和可靠性等特点。它的源代码被公开发布,使得开发者可以根据自己的需求进行自由地修改,以创造出新的应用程序和操作系统。由于Linux源代码的公开性,开发者们可以通过直接下载源代码来学习Linux操作系统的内部结构。

那么如何下载Linux的源代码呢?以下是一些简单的步骤:

1. 前往Linux的官方网站(https://www.kernel.org/)。

2. 点击“Download”按钮,进入下载页面。

3. 在“Latest Stable Kernel”部分,选择你需要下载的版本。

4. 移动到底部,点击“HTTP”以获取HTTP中的链接地址。

5. 从Terminal调用以下命令,将源代码下载到计算机中:

wget https://cdn.kernel.org/pub/linux/kernel/v5.x/linux-5.14.12.tar.xz

6. 解压缩下载的文件:

tar -xf linux-5.14.12.tar.xz

7. 完成后,你就可以开始分析Linux的开源代码了。

使用Linux开发的首要工具是Linux内核源代码(Kernel)。此外,GNU工具链、QEMU和GCC也是相当重要的开发工具。当然,如果你的项目需要使用其他特定的库和组件,你还需要下载和安装这些软件。

对于初学者来说,建议下载一个早期的内核版本。这些早期版本的内核源代码通常比较简单,便于学习。当你对该内核的基础了解足够后,你就可以移步到更高版本的内核上。

Linux内核源代码是一份非常巨大的代码库,对于初学者来说,一定要掌握好搜索的技巧。通常情况下,比较重要的部分都有其专门的文档和注释。此外,许多开源社区都维护了一些用于学习Linux内核源代码的指南和教程。这些指南和教程可以帮助你快速地入门。

学习Linux内核源代码的过程需要耗费大量的时间和精力。但是,毋庸置疑,这是一种非常有益的经验。通过研究Linux内核源代码,可以极大地提高你的编程技能和对OS的理解。那么,就让我们开始自己的Linux内核之旅吧!


数据运维技术 » 下载Linux代码:学习开源操作系统编程的必备步骤(linux代码下载)